What is life cycle of Leishmania donovani?
Life cycle of Leishmania donovani: The parasite has two stages in its life cycle: Amastigote form: occurring in humans and mammals. Promastigote form: occurring in sandfly.
Where is Leishmania donovani found?
Visceral leishmaniasis caused by Leishmania donovani is endemic in parts of India, Africa, and South-West Asia. Full-blown visceral leishmaniasis manifests clinically with fever, weight loss, hepatosplenomegaly, cytopenia, and hypergammaglobulinemia, although it is suspected that most human infections are subclinical.

What is the infective stage of Leishmania donovani?
Leishmaniasis is transmitted by the bite of female phlebotomine sandflies. The sandflies inject the infective stage, promastigotes, during blood meals . Promastigotes that reach the puncture wound are phagocytized by macrophages and transform into amastigotes .

Which is the smallest genome?
Mycoplasma genitalium has the smallest genome of any organism that can be grown in pure culture. It has a minimal metabolism and little genomic redundancy. Consequently, its genome is expected to be a close approximation to the minimal set of genes needed to sustain bacterial life.

How many gaps are there in the L donovani genome?
The current L. donovani reference genome (ASM22713v2 from strain BPK282A 8) was generated using second generation technologies and contains over 2,000 gaps and therefore there are many incomplete or inaccurate protein coding sequences.
